  3. Thank you, Margo and Caroline!

    The pattern is easy and uses only a few stitches: knit; purl; yarn over; knit 2 together; slip, slip, knit; and slip one, knit 2 together, pass slipped stitch over.

    None of those stitches/techniques are anything fancy, and the pattern is fun to watch as it emerges. And every other row is just a purl row.
